I see the picture, sorry if I am thinking wrong, I am just going off of the top of my head. I thought that there were only two small screws holding the ignitor in, they are the same thread pitch as the two small screws holding the small wires on to the ignition coil. It is possible to swap these screws but if the ignitor screws are installed into the ignition coil, they are too long and they will pull the contacts out of the coil and break the internal connection, killing the coil. BTDT sorry to say, is this not your setup?
